Kate Middleton, the Princess of Wales, undergoes surgery on her abdomen

Kate Middleton, the Princess of Wales, underwent a "scheduled abdominal surgery" at The London Clinic, according to media reports referencing a statement from Kensington Palace. The statement indicated that the surgery was successful, and she is anticipated to stay in the hospital for a period of ten to fourteen days before heading home to continue her recovery. The announcement further stated that, following current medical advice, it is unlikely she will resume public duties until after Easter. As per the statement, the Princess of Wales is expected to remain hospitalized for approximately two weeks.



In the continuation of the statement, it was expressed that the Princess of Wales is grateful for the anticipated interest in this announcement. She hopes that the public will empathize with her desire to maintain a sense of normalcy for her children and her preference for keeping personal medical details private. The statement further clarified that Kensington Palace will provide updates on Her Royal Highness' progress only when there is significant new information to share. Abdominal surgery, as a medical procedure, involves making incisions in the abdominal area to address various conditions or diseases affecting organs such as the stomach, liver, intestines, or appendix. Surgeons may conduct abdominal surgeries to remove tumors, treat digestive disorders, repair hernias, or address injuries. These surgeries can take the form of open procedures with large incisions or minimally invasive techniques like laparoscopy, which involves smaller incisions and specialized tools. The overarching goal of abdominal surgery is to diagnose, treat, or alleviate medical issues within the abdominal cavity, ultimately promoting the health and well-being of the patient.
